• 1
  • 2(current)
  • 3
  • 4
  • 5
  • 9
Watched/unwatched flag
#16
another good point spiff.

i decided to add the watched view so i had an easy way to remove it from the watched list if a mistake was made or someone wants to mark it back as unwatched. (rather than having to use the title view and onpopup determine if the movie has been watched or not, onpopup i just determine what view i'm in and add a menu item for mark unwatched or mark watched) also, you don't have to dig through your entire movie list to find the one mistake you made. check the logic on that and see if you'd still just have a title view and unwatched view.

now, to luna, at first i tried adding a bool field to the movie table, but when i did all the other queries to the database failed for some reason. (anyone got a clue about why that would happen?) and i didnt' want to modify all the queries for genre, year, actor...

also, i just noticed that regardless of the view it says myvideoo -title, so i'll fix that up before i submit the patch.

one quick question since i'm new to the boards. what is the best way to let the people, in the suggestions/request link that gamester17 posted, know about this and to try and stirr up more exitement about this patch? (i don't want to violate any rules like linking to posts or copying posts or anything)
Reply
#17
nice work so far...

im not sure why you were unable to add a field to the existing movie database. but, if you were to add a "lastwatched" field, and a "lastwatched" field to cimdbmovie, you could sort by last watched.

this would be really cool when used along with the autowatch option.
Always read the XBMC online-manual, FAQ and search the forum before posting.
Do not e-mail XBMC-Team members directly asking for support. Read/follow the forum rules.
For troubleshooting and bug reporting please make sure you read this first.
Reply
#18
looks great so far! best way to let people know is to go back to that thread and just leave a message that it's been submitted as a patch, add a pic or two and a link to the patch. i would be careful about linking to the dev boards here because you might end up with this thread being cluttered by useless responses, but i don't believe there are any rules against it.

i have to agree with luna about tying it in with the existing database, but i bet this initial patch will get a lot of dev attention since the current views for videos are good, but not quite on par with the music views. this would be a great enhancement. Smile

regards,
los93sol
Reply
#19
i ran into some problems using the existing tables but kraqh3d is lending some assistance there, so probably tonight when i get home i'll update it.

another noob question i have is:
how exactly do i submit a "patch"? do i submit the changed files and everyone that wants it has to recompile them, or is there something i'm missing?
Reply
#20
valid point indeed.

just submit the modified files at our sourceforge page.
Reply
#21
a quick note about submitting the patch, little notes are good, it is nice to know what date/time of cvs the modified files came from since as the files are changed throughout revisions they can have conflicts and not compile correctly. this is not an issue for developers who know the code and know what they are doing but for end users who do their own compiles to test it, most of them will not be able to unless they have the proper cvs date/time and just replace the original files with your modified version. just a suggestion. Smile

regards,
los93sol
Reply
#22
ok guys, i stabalized the patch and got it to work the way i imagined. if anyone gives it a shot and likes/dislikes it let me know.

patch download

this patch was developed for the 2005-09-12 cvs, but works for quite a few of the previous versions. i

don't know of anyone doing work on the changed files, so i imagine it should work for quite some time.

this patch add the fallowing features:
1:list video's by watched
2:list video's by unwatched
3:mark video as unwatched in watched view
4:mark video as watched in unwatched view
5:edit video titles in title, watched, and unwatched views

notes:
1:the watched/unwatched views will not show up unless title/watched/unwatched is selected as the active

view. i.e. if you open my videos and it defaults to show files, then move to titles and watched and

unwatched will appear in the show list.

to add use this patch:

1:dump the xbmc folder over the cvs xbmc folder.
2:rebuild
3:dump the skin and language folder over your skin and language folder.
4:enjoy

changes from base:
1Confusedkin file labels the description label so it can change from my videos - title to my videos - watched

and my videos - unwatched.
2:added functions to support above functionality
3:modified guiwindowvideotitle.cpp to call getvideos with watched/unwatched flag set
Reply
#23
i can't wait to see this being in the cvs great work, i will use this a lot.
Reply
#24
now that is the thing my wife will love, she has 20 shows of lost on the disk and she always forgets what she had watched :-(

how can i as a non developer (too dumb to compile) use this feature? it is not in the 27-9 build :-(

yours

jerry
Reply
#25
(spiff @ sep. 08 2005,19:25 Wrote:i welcome the addition. it can be moved into the video library if it gets added (sort of like top100 in my music).

i might do the overlay thing as well, there is no conflict between the two methods as such.

however, you'll have to convince more ppl than just me before it gets added Smile
i would like such feature, i was the one that proposed flags or something, so my wife has different flag and i have different. your approach i would like such feature, i was the one that proposed flags or something, so my wife has different flag and i have different. your approach seems excellent to me!seems excellent to me!
Reply
#26
as for getting the feature, since its a patch you must (or someone you know must) compile the application with the patches applied. (no other way until its in the public cvs)

i've been working on getting it coded to a standard they won't mind putting in the cvs and should have it completed this weekend. (then they'll review cretique and i'll be back to the drawing board)

i am open to the idea of a watched list by user, and wouldn't mind puting it in the patches.

give me some sugestions on how you plan on using it, (since they probly won't like me using profiels to distinguish)
Reply
#27
(mercuryinc @ oct. 08 2005,01:25 Wrote:as for getting the feature, since its a patch you must (or someone you know must) compile the application with the patches applied. (no other way until its in the public cvs)

i've been working on getting it coded to a standard they won't mind putting in the cvs and should have it completed this weekend. (then they'll review cretique and i'll be back to the drawing board)

i am open to the idea of a watched list by user, and wouldn't mind puting it in the patches.

give me some sugestions on how you plan on using it, (since they probly won't like me using profiels to distinguish)
personally i would like to flag the file's using a filter to cycle trough them:

person a (seen --> not seen --> all
person b (seen --> not seen --> all

well and if we are already flagging files, rating them would also be nice, especially if we could rate the movies directly into imdb accounts (but that’s something else).

i’m looking forward to find it in the cvs to play around with.

no profiles that's bad…. profiles could also be nice to setup a fresh xbmc quicker, now i have to set the all options once in a while again. even i can save profiles in xbmc i would like to be able to in/export them…..



Reply
#28
i would use a different colour flags, like blue for me and red for wife etc. that would be the ultimate system imho, because as it is now if one in the family watches a series ahead of the other the marking is not that powerfull (only one can see where he/she is)...

please don't ban me here, i see now this forum is only for developers anyway and i shouldn't even post here :-( as binaries are not found here and from what i read they are illegal? so it is not possible (allowed) for anyone to send me the modified binaries without breaking the law (which of course i don't want :-)? i would so much like to test this feature as implemented and i then make some more suggestions.

another point, different, is about making bookmarks in files (the place where you stopped). they are stored in a global file in each xbox. well, i and i guess an not alone, have 2 xboxes, so if i watch a movie on one and create bookmark i can not have this bookmark on another one. as i have external server for moview all i would like is to be alble to store this bookmarks on this server, so i can have them "globally". is that even theoretically possible?

and again, thank you for making a patch for watched/unwatched? i made a few posts but nobody seems to care about it and i thought: am i the only one that have several series on the disk and don't remember what i looked last (and doesn't delete it because of other family members who may watch it also)...

yours

jerry
Reply
#29
i'm probably not going to be able to add persanolized watched/unwatched this weekend, but it something i also want so i'll keep it in mind.

i like your global bookmark idea, however i see two problems. 1 its outside the scope of this particular project (but it would also be cool to personolize the bookmarks). and 2 if you give your xbox permission to write and change files on your server its possible that the xbox could also delete them. i also keep my video's on the network, and my wife usualy hits the wrong buttons Smile i always come up with video's missing so i disabled the video deleting in the title screen. (hopefully you can relateSmile)

i'm hopinig that if they like they way i've got the patch this weekend they'll put it in the cvs soon
Reply
#30
i like the watched/unwatched features... very useful.

one suggestion...

what about integrating a marker/highlight into the standard views that would enable you to know if the video was no watched?

i.e. in the normal title view, if a video had not been watched yet the text would have a marker to let you know...

small eye img
circle with slash img
color bar underlining text (change color to use profiles).
I'm not an expert but I play one at work.
Reply
  • 1
  • 2(current)
  • 3
  • 4
  • 5
  • 9

Logout Mark Read Team Forum Stats Members Help
Watched/unwatched flag0